Birds, deer and a variety of small mammals (including opossums as the common name suggests) are attracted to the fruit.Genus name comes from the Latin name Quercus ilex for holm oak in reference to the foliage similarities (holm oak and many of the shrubs in the genus Ilex have evergreen leaves).Specific epithet refers to the species being deciduous not evergreen like most hollies. Other Names: Possum Haw, Deciduous Holly, Bearberry, A versatile large shrub or small tree with showy deep red berries throughout winter, requires a male pollinator to produce the berries; does best in moist acidic soils, good for problem areas; one of the last to drop leaves in fall.
